Peaceful site with countryside views

In summary, we found this one of the best CLs we have ever stayed on. We picked it at random in order to visit an area we are unfamiliar with and we weren't disappointed. The site is elevated and looks across rolling countryside with views west to the distant Pennines. The suggested pitches are well spaced with plenty of room between them and the site was well maintained. It is sloping in places but this can easily be overcome with a ramp block or other method. The area has numerous public footpaths but the local roads require care when on foot due to blind bends, although, they are not too busy. We can personally recommend the nearby Galphay Inn for food and drink, where we were made to feel very welcome. This is a site we will visit again.

Always a pleasure to come here

We have been coming to West Leas for a number of years now and always receive a really warm welcome from Catherine and Adrian. The paths mowed through the fields to walk along are brilliant. You can walk directly across the fields to Galphay (about a mile each way) and the local pub, or in the other direction to the paper shop and butcher/baker in Kirkby Malzeard (again about a mile each way). Our border collie (and us for that matter!) hates to leave when its time to go home. This must be one of the best CL's in N Yorkshire.

Lovely CL

We spent 6 nights at this CL. It is a lovely CL and all the pitches are grass. The views are lovely and the site is very quiet. We never saw the owner which considering we were there for so long was a bit disappointing. The chemical waste disposal is not pleasant being a wc standing proudly in full view. It works well enough though. We use our own facilities, but the toilet and shower didn't look great although it was clean. The CL is convenient for Fountains Abbey but it is almost 8 miles from Ripon and the roads are generally narrow. It is a very good CL but could be better.

Call of the Curlew

Just spent two fantastic weeks at this wonderful site. Quiet, tranquil and relaxing, the scenery is worth the stay alone. The owners were helpful, yet discreet. Sheep graze in the surrounding fields; high above, the regular sight and sound of the Curlews take you far away from the hustle and bustle of everyday life. There is a small village within both cycling and walking distance. Great local butchers, small shop and a pub all si along the main square. We enjoyed a bike ride into Ripon which is a lovely market town; if you're into visiting excellent attractions the majestic Fountains Abbey is close by. Only slight point: the toilet/shower facility is partly finished. The toilet is functional, but staring at a half finished shower cubicle and relevant fixtures is a disappointment. I understand the reasons for not being able to use it but at least it could be finished off.

Very enjoyable stay at excellent CL

West Leas proved an excellent choice for our first outing since Covid restrictions for the second year were eased. We were welcomed by Catherine on arrival, and found the site very well maintained, with very good facilities - the toilet emptying point even has flushing, and to have free WiFi on a CL is still exceptional. The field is sloping, but pitching was no problem with chocks, and having chosen the pitch at the top, views were great especially of the sunsets. The delightful village of Kirkby Malzeard is only about 20 minutes walk - I recommend the locally baked cakes at the village stores. There are lovely local walks taking in other villages such as Galphay, and plenty of quiet lanes for cycling. Fountains Abbey is easily accessible by cycle or car. A great discovery for us was the amazing Himalayan Garden and Sculpture Park at Grewelthorpe, where there is also Hackfall Wood. Ripon is about 20 minutes by car and well served by supermarkets especially the high quality Booths.

A really wonderful farm CL

Simply one of the best CL's we have visited. Ideally situated for touring both the Yorkshire Dales and the North York Moors National Parks as well as many interesting towns and villages. The site is well kept grass with good drainage on a slight slope. The approach roads from Ripon can be a bit of a test as they seem to breed rather large tractors in Yorkshire and this site is set in a real rural area. The views from the site are over miles of fields and in the distance the heather clad moors. A great place for dogs as well. We stayed for a total of 7 days at either end of our caravan holiday and loved every minute of them. TV and WiFi reception is fantastic as well. Mr & Mrs Raw, the owners, are very cheerful and helpful. We will certainly be stopping there again!
